Advantages Of The Biomass Boiler Using

Biomass Boilers
From a few years for some household, biomass boilers have become a popular choice, especially for people who want to heat their homes as cheaply as possible, and for peoples who are unable to use gas heating. Biomass boiler is popular because it is convenient and cheap solution for your home heating, especially for country houses.
If for some reason you do not have access to gas heating, or simply you don't want to use gas heating, and you are considering choosing another optimal heating system for your home, I'd like to invite you to familiarize with biomass boiler.
Currently, on the market, customers have a wide range of biomass boilers to choose.
Biomass boilers like all devices, they have their disadvantages and advantages, but under some conditions, the choice of heating a home with the use of biomass boilers is the best choice, especially if you have a country house.
The most important advantages of biomass boiler
• Low costs of operating - if you want to save some money on heating, you should choose a biomass boiler to ...
... install at your home. Natural gas, electricity or heating oil generate big costs for heating your home and currently, none of that fuels can compete with the cost of biomass.
• Convenience of biomass boiler using - biomass boilers are not burdensome in operation, because they don't need special attention per every day. It is enough to fill the boiler tray with good quality biomass fuel, and the next visit to the boiler room can be after a few days.
From time to time, you should remember to remove ashes from the boiler, but there is much less ash than when burning coal.
For biomass boiler user, very important is to remember that one or two time per year need to hire biomass boiler specialist for maintenance of boiler. The best is to invite a licenced engineer specialist about biomass boilers.
• Cleanliness - unlike a coal-fired boiler room, a biomass boiler room can be clean and should be clean. Biomass is clean and the burning of the biomass produces a pleasant wood smell, that is why a biomass boiler can even be located in the living area of a house. Procedure of removing ash from burned biomass does not raise dust, so don't worry to make dirty or dusty your house.
• Versatility of biomass boiler - modern biomass boilers are adapted to burning of various fuels, not only typical biomass. The basic types of biomass always burn without problems, but in special cases while using less common biomass fuels, needs to change burner.
• Ecology - biomass boilers are devices that fully meet the ecological criteria. Biomass is 100% renewable clean fuel.
The energy we are getting from biomass burning is called green energy, because it is carbon-neutral.
Biomass boilers connect the interests of the user with the needs of the environment, and they are a great heating choice when modernizing an old building, and a good choice for a new building in the countryside.
Biomass energy is carbon-neutral.
In summ:
Modern wood biomass boilers meet emission standards and are fully automated, all that means that they are often installed in newly built country houses.
For some time, big, industrial biomass boilers have been successfully used to supply whole estates of single-family houses and multifamily buildings with thermal energy.
For every user, the biggest advantage of biomass boiler using is the fact that modern boilers do not require any burdensome maintenance and process is automated.
